St. Mary's College Under 19s beat Sripalee outright

Thisaru Priyalalitha
Under 19 cricket team of St. Mary's College recorded a great victory against Sripalee College, Horana in a Sri Lanka School Cricket Association tournament match played in Sripalee ground, Horana.

St. Mary's beat Sripalee by 9 wickets outright despite they were 33 runs behind in the first innings.

St. Mary's won the toss and let Sripalee to bat. Sripalee College team was all out for 155.

St. Mary's could score only 122 in the first innings.

Playing with extreme determination on the second day St. Mary's boys reduced Sripalee College to 66 all out in overs in the second innings. St. Mary's captain Kasun Samera de Alwis excelled taking 8 wickets for 32 in his spellbound left arm off spinning. He bagged 10 wickets for 62 in the two innings.

St. Mary's former captain Thisaru Priyalalitha scored an unbeaten half century in its for 01 to win the match.
